Description

The environmental data and analytics landscape is complex and fragmented. Many organisations are involved in the creation, curation, integration and analysis of environmental data and information.

The Western Australian Biodiversity Science Institute (WABSI), the Western Australian Marine Science Institution (WAMSI) and the Australian Research Data Commons (ARDC), along with several partners, including the Australian Government, are working on initiatives which need to be integrated and interoperable across multiple domains, organisations and data holdings. To succeed, they require a common view of all elements of the environmental data and analytics landscape.

The updated Shared Analytic Framework for the Environment (SAFE 2.0) presented in this document provides a common vocabulary to show how the many components of the environmental data landscape work together. It will help understand how the components might best work together to deliver specific reporting and analysis needs; to understand areas where further development is needed; and help identify what is required to deliver a a national supply chain of environmental information.

The framework is intended to:

  • facilitate a consistent view of the required capabilities and their interdependencies across varied stakeholders
  • develop an organisational, maturity and investment view tailored to specific needs
  • individual projects determine the capabilities that they need; and
  • align effort, reduce fragmentation, and prioritise investment across the capabilities that support information supply chains.

The framework is intended to be used by:

  • individuals: to understand the complexity of the environmental data and analytics landscape
  • institutions: to better understand institutional contributions to the national supply chain of environmental information, as well as dependencies between such institutions and their capabilities; and
  • funding bodies: to promote a consistent, coherent view of a complex landscape, better enabling the mapping of maturity and the planning of investment.
